A long straight wire is parallel to one edge and is in the plane of a single-turn rectangular loop as shown. If the loop is moving in the plane shown so that the distance x changes at a constant rate of 20 cm/s, what is the magnitude of the emf induced in the loop at the instant x = 5.0 cm? Let I = 50 A, a = 50 cm, b = 6.0 cm. A long straight wire is parallel to one edge and is in the plane of a single-turn rectangular loop as shown.
